despite reassurance

Frequency: 6.05.5 per million words

Used to show a contrast, where something happens even with reassurance.

Examples (10)

  • She kept looking in the mirror despite my constant reassurances that her hair looked fine.
  • The market remained volatile despite reassurance from the central bank.
  • Despite repeated reassurances, she still felt unsafe walking home alone.
  • The rumors persisted despite reassurance from the CEO.
  • He checked the lock again despite reassurance that the door was secure.
  • Despite reassurance regarding the weather, the event was cancelled.
  • Many residents evacuated despite reassurance that the flood barriers would hold.
  • The child continued to cry despite reassurance from his parents.
  • Despite official reassurances, doubts about the project's timeline remained.
  • We decided to cancel the trip despite reassurance that the area was safe.
